netherer
† ˈnetherer Obs. rare. [f. nether a. + -er3.] a. The lower parts. b. An inferior.a 1340 Hampole Psalter cxxxviii. 14 My substaunce in neþerere of erth. c 1449 Pecock Repr. Prol. 1 Correccioun..which longith oonli to the ouerer anentis his netherer, and not to the netherer anentis his ouerer.
